Common Causes of Unintended Friendly Fire Incidents

Unintended friendly fire incidents often occur due to several interconnected causes. Misidentification remains a leading factor, often resulting from faulty communication or unclear target recognition. In high-pressure combat situations, even experienced personnel may mistake allies for adversaries, leading to tragic errors.

Another common cause involves technological failures or limitations. Identification Friend or Foe (IFF) systems, while advanced, are not infallible and can produce false positives or negatives. Additionally, communication breakdowns between units can hinder coordination, increasing the likelihood of accidental engagements.

Identification Friend or Foe (IFF) Systems

Identification Friend or Foe (IFF) systems are vital technological tools used to distinguish between allied and adversary forces during military operations. They employ electronic signals to identify friendly units, reducing the risk of unintended friendly fire incidents.

Typically, IFF systems operate through a series of coded transponders mounted on military vehicles, aircraft, or ships. These transponders respond to interrogations from IFF radar systems, confirming the identity of the unit. Key elements include:

  1. Transmitters and Receivers: To send and receive identification signals.
  2. Coding Protocols: Unique codes that differentiate friendly forces.
  3. Interrogation Signals: Sent periodically to verify identity.
  4. Compatibility: Must work seamlessly across various military platforms and with allied forces.

Implementing effective IFF systems has significantly enhanced battlefield safety by minimizing friendly fire. Continuous technological advancements, such as encryption and autonomous identification, are further improving their reliability in complex combat environments.
